charge = 1260
n = 0
n = charge // 500
s = ((charge)-500*n) // 100
k = (((charge)-500*n) - 100*s) // 50
l = ((((charge)-500*n) - 100*s) - 50*k) // 10
print(n+s+k+l) # 나의 풀이
n = 1260
count = 0
coin_types = [500, 100, 50, 10] # 큰 단위의 화폐부터
for coin in coin_types:
count += n // coin # 해당 화폐로 거슬러 줄 수 있는 동전의 개수 새기
n %= coin
print(count)
'Python > 이것이 취업을 위한 코딩 테스트다(with 파이썬)' 카테고리의 다른 글
이것이 취업을 위한 코딩 테스트다 곱하기 혹은 더하기 (0) | 2022.05.28 |
---|---|
이것이 취업을 위한 코딩테스트다 모험가 길드 (0) | 2022.05.28 |
이것이 취업을 위한 코딩테스트다 (예제3-5) (0) | 2022.05.28 |
이것이 취업을 위한 코딩테스트다 (예제 3-2) (0) | 2022.05.28 |
이것이 취업을 위한 코딩 테스트다 (예제 3-2) (0) | 2022.05.24 |